Luria-Nebraska Neuropsychological Battery
A screening tool used by clinicians to determine if significant brain injury or psychological impairments are present or to distinguish between brain damage and mental health disorders.
Memory Deficits
Impairments in the ability to remember information or events, which can result from neurological conditions, injury, or psychological factors.
Brain Injury
Physical damage to the brain, which can result in temporary or permanent impairment of cognitive, physical, and psychosocial functions.
CHC Model
Stands for the Cattell-Horn-Carroll theory, a psychological theory that attempts to describe human cognitive abilities and their variations as a set of factors.
